Northwood Community Primary School (With Designated Special Provision) Catchment Area
Northwood Community Primary School (With Designated Special Provision) is a community primary school in Kirkby, Knowsley , serving pupils aged 3-11, with 473 pupils, and a capacity of 572 places. Find catchment area guidance, admissions policy details and nearby primary schools below.

Northwood Community Primary School (With Designated Special Provision) Catchment Area Information
What is the catchment area for Northwood Community Primary School (With Designated Special Provision)?
The catchment area for Northwood Community Primary School (With Designated Special Provision) is the geographic zone Knowsley uses to prioritise admissions when this primary school receives more applications than it has places. Children living inside the boundary are ranked higher under the oversubscription criteria, after looked-after children and siblings. Knowsley publishes the exact boundary and the last distance offered before each admissions cycle, and the boundary can change year to year.
The catchment area for Northwood Community Primary School (With Designated Special Provision) is set by Knowsley and reviewed annually. Children living within the catchment boundary receive priority consideration when applications exceed the number of available places.
The official admissions policy, including the catchment boundary map, is published by Knowsley before each admissions cycle. Always verify your address with the council before submitting an application, as boundaries can change year to year.

Northwood Community Primary School (With Designated Special Provision) has a published admission number of 572 places. 473 pupils were enrolled in the most recent data, giving a fill rate of 83%. At 83% full, the school currently has headroom below its 572 place limit. Catchment distance criteria still apply when the school is oversubscribed, but at current demand levels, places have been available for applicants outside the immediate catchment area.
The fill-rate figure above reflects overall demand, but the school's intake also varies by community profile. 64.5% of pupils at Northwood Community Primary School (With Designated Special Provision) are eligible for free school meals, above the national average of around 24%. This reflects the school's role in a higher-deprivation area of Kirkby.
